SCOOP: An @theintercept.com analysis finds that almost all Republican-led states — 23 of the 27 with Republican governors — have deployed National Guard troops in support of Trump’s war on immigrants or military occupations of Blue cities

theintercept.com/2025/10/09/r...
Republican Governors Eagerly Join Trump’s Military Campaign Against Blue Cities
An Intercept analysis finds nearly every Republican governor has deployed National Guard members to aid Trump’s domestic military agenda.

Elon Musk’s DOGE never came close to cutting as much money by Sept. 30, when the government closes its books on the fiscal year, as he promised. Because its work has been obscured by crude accounting and White House maneuvers, it’s impossible to know how much DOGE actually did cut from the budget.
Not Even Congress Knows How Much Money DOGE Cut
Elon Musk’s team started a behind-the-scenes push for White House control over federal spending that is now an undercurrent of the government shutdown.
